Principal Engineer, Compiler
Job Summary
Renesas HPC チームの AI コンパイラエンジニアとして次世代 3nm プロセスを含む Renesas の自動車向け次世代 SoC プラットフォームにおいてその計算能力を最大限に引き出す コンパイラおよびコード生成技術の開発を担っていただきます
本ポジションでは知覚処理センサーフュージョン車載アシスタント先進運転支援ADASなどの AI ワークロードをRenesas ハードウェア上で高度に最適化し安全かつ省電力に実行可能な形式へ変換するプロセスに直接貢献いただきます
ソフトウェアコンパイラ開発AI モデルのロワリング最適化ハードウェアソフトウェア共設計の領域を横断しマルチドメイン自動車アプリケーションに求められる業界競争力のある性能効率機能安全を Renesas SoC で実現する技術的中核となる役割です
Job Description
- モデル入力からグラフ最適化ロワリングコード生成ランタイム統合までを含む AI コンパイラアーキテクチャの設計および技術リード
- オペレータ融合量子化対応リライトメモリ考慮型スケジューリングパーティショニングなどの グラフレベル最適化の設計実装
- 対象 NPU 向けの 性能最適化タイル化テンソルレイアウト設計マルチコア実行戦略 等の推進
- SoCAI アクセラレータアーキテクトと密に連携しコンパイラ視点からハードウェア機能の方向性に影響を与える技術提案
- シミュレータプロファイラシリコン相関モデルを活用した 実車載 AI ワークロードにおける性能 KPI の定義および評価
- コンパイラ出力が **自動車要件リアルタイム性決定性品質安全基準**を満たすことの保証
- 直接的なピープルマネジメントは伴わないもののシニアエンジニアへのメンタリングおよび技術的方向性の提示
Impact & Differentiators
Renesas の Gen5 R-Car 自動車向け SoC ラインアップフラッグシップとなる 3nm デバイス R-Car X5H を含むはADASIVIゲートウェイ次世代 SDV ワークロードを 集中型プラットフォームで実行することを目的に設計された業界初期の高度統合マルチドメイン自動車 SoC です
これらのプラットフォームは
- 数百 TOPS クラスの高い AI 演算性能
- スケーラブルなチップレットベースのアクセラレーション
- 電動化自動運転車に求められる優れた電力効率
- 厳格な機能安全要件への対応
といった特長を備えています
AI コンパイラエンジニアは最先端の AI モデルや計算カーネルを シリコン上に最適にマッピングすることでこのハードウェアビジョンを具現化し性能向上レイテンシおよび消費電力の削減ソフトウェアエコシステムの採用加速に直接貢献します
計算効率と安全性が極めて重要な自動車エコシステムにおいて不可欠かつ高い影響力を持つポジションです
Qualifications :
Must-Have
- コンピュータサイエンス電気工学または関連分野における 修士号博士号または同等の実務経験
- AI コンパイラアクセラレータバックエンドまたはグラフ最適化フレームワークにおける深い開発経験
- NPUカスタムアクセラレータ向け グラフ最適化および性能最適化の高度な専門性
- MLIRLLVMTVM 系フレームワークまたは独自コンパイラ IRの実務経験
- 優れた C/C および Python プログラミングスキル
- CNNTransformer認識モデル生成モデルなどの AI 推論ワークロードへの理解
- Scrum チームでのアジャイル開発経験など高いコミュニケーション能力
Nice-to-Have
- 自動車分野または 安全クリティカルシステムに関する知見
- CPUGPUDSPNPU を含む ヘテロジニアス SoC のバックグラウンド
- 性能モデリングや ハードウェアソフトウェア共設計の経験
その他の情報 :
ルネサスはTo Make Our Lives Easier 人々の暮らしを楽ラクにするというPurposeの下組み込み半導体ソリューションを提供します高品質とシステムレベルノウハウを兼ね備えた組み込み半導体のリーダーとして自動車産業インフラIoT分野向けにハイパフォーマンスコンピューティング組み込みプロセッシングアナログコネクティビティそしてパワーを含めた幅広い製品ポートフォリオを軸としたスケーラブルで包括的なソリューションを提供しています
ルネサスは30か国以上で22000 人を超える多様性あふれる従業員と共に限界に挑戦しながらデジタライゼーションを通じてユーザエクスペリエンスを充実化させ新たなイノベーションの時代を切り開いていきますそして世界中の人々やコミュニティの未来のために持続可能で省エネ効果の高いソリューションの開発に全力で取り組みTo Make Our Lives Easierを実現します
ルネサスで実現できること
- キャリアをスタートそしてキャリアアップ4つのプロダクトグループをはじめさまざまな部門において技術職としてまた幅広いビジネスの経験を積むことができますハードウェアソフトウェアの専門知識を深めたり新しいことにチャレンジしたりする機会があります
- やりがいとインパクトのある仕事をする 革新的な製品とソリューションの開発に関わることにより世界中のお客様のニーズに応えると同時に人々の生活をより便利で安全かつ安心なものにすることに貢献できます
- ウェルビーイングに焦点を置いた環境で最大限に能力を発揮するルネサスではリモートワーク制度などによる柔軟な勤務体制づくりまた従業員リソースグループの積極的な活動をサポートするなどインクルーシブな職場環境構築を目指しています従業員を第一に考えたカルチャーとグローバルなサポート体制が入社後すぐに活躍できる環境を提供します
自分の力で成功を掴みキャリアを築く準備はできていますか
ルネサスで一緒に未来を形づくっていきましょう
当社ではハイブリッド勤務モデルを採用しており従業員は週に2日間リモートワークを行うことができます同時に残りの日はチームとしてオフィスに集まり協働を強化しています出社指定日は火曜日から木曜日でイノベーションコラボレーションそして継続的な学習に取り組む日としています
Remote Work :
No
Employment Type :
Full-time
Key Skills
- Design
- Academics
- AutoCAD 3D
- Cafe
- Fabrication
- Java
About Company
In the sustainable food sector, we work with large food companies, providing them with professional consulting services to help them add sustainable food to their supply chains, thereby improving food safety and food quality, and improving animal welfare. Our partners include leading ... View more